Sorcery and Sanctity: A Homage to Arthur Machen

Rate this book
Anthology of 20 short stories published to celebrate the 150th anniversary of the birth of Arthur Machen.

178 pages, Hardcover

First published January 1, 2013

I have not read much by Arthur Machen, So for me this is a type of introduction to his work. After finishing I know I need to discover more.

The contributors to this book made me also order a few more books to allow me to further explore writings by them.

The CONTENTS of the books are:

NIGREDO

A Blue Dish of Figs by Colin Insole
The Desolation of Albion by Derek John
The Knife That Cuts by DJ Tyrer
No Coward Soul Is Mine by DJ Tyrer
A Kiss by Moonlight by DJ Tyrer
Mr Egare by D.P. Watt
Est Enim Magnum Chaos by Steve Rasnic Tem
Caerdroia by Thana Niveau

ALBEDO

The Sins of Horton by John Gale
Transfigured Night by Godfrey Brangham
Queen of The Iceni by Brendan Connell
The Organist by Brendan Connell
The Bells of St Quentin by Iain Smith
The Vale of Gold by Jonathan Wood
Great Seizers’ Ghosts by Avalon Brantley

RUBEDO

The Shape and Colour of The Moon by John Howard
An Image of Truth by Ron Weighell
Evensong by Thomas Strømsholt
The House of Flame by Mark Valentine
In Eternity – Two Lines Intersect by Mark Samuels
